Bedford Fire Department Offers 'File of Life'

Service may help save lives.

Submitted by the Bedford Fire Department:

The Bedford Fire Department is offering the “File of Life” to Bedford residents.  The service offers residents a form to provide their personal health information and store it conspicuously on their home refrigerator in a plastic magnetized sleeve.  Bedford Fire Department Emergency Medical Service personnel are trained to look for this to gain patient information quickly and easily.  The benefit is quality patient care.  Time saved gathering information is critical in life saving situations when seconds count.  Information provided is medical history, medications and emergency contacts. In the case of illness or injury, a patient is not always able to communicate with ambulance personnel and may not have anyone else at home to help provide the information.  The File of Life will aid in gathering this information.  Bedford Fire Department urges residents that may need its ambulance service to obtain a File, complete the form and update it as needed.  The File of Life can be obtained at the Bedford Fire Department.  If you have questions about the service, please contact Scott Hunter, Fire Inspector: 603-792-1369 or shunter@bedfordnh.org.
